Proper mobile phase selection significantly improved high-performance ion-exchange fractionations of proteins. The pH and salt content of the eluant affected chromatographic behavior on both strong and weak ion-exchange columns. Mössbauer experiments have been performed on Nafion ion exchange membranes neutralized with iron chloride. The recoilless fraction falls to zero at a temperature which depends on the water content, showing that the rigidity of the local ion environment is greatly influenced by the amount of water retained in these membranes.
